Science Applications International Corporation (SAIC) has been awarded a contract by Space and Naval Warfare Systems Center Atlantic (SPAWARSYSCEN Atlantic) to help procure and deliver command and control (C2) equipment and services.

The $500m multiple-award indefinite-delivery, indefinite-quantity (ID/IQ) contract has a one-year base period of performance and options for four additional one-year periods.

Under the contract, the company will provide programme management and technical support services, as well as help procure equipment, systems and supplies as per the requirements.

SAIC is one of six contractors that will compete for task orders under the contract.

Work will be carried out in Maryland and South Carolina, US.
